What does a score of 40 mean?

ClawSecure assigned agent-council a security score of 40/100, placing it in the High Risk range. This is driven by 9 findings led by Malicious Code that should be addressed before use. ClawSecure derives this score with a weighted deduction model (critical -20, high -10, medium -5, low -2 from a base of 100).

Harden command execution
agent-council constructs or runs system commands. Validate that commands are built only from trusted inputs, never pass user-controlled strings directly to a shell, and restrict execution to an allow-list of expected commands.
